The global MedTech community gathered for the MedTech Conference on October 24-26 in Boston, MA, hosted by Advamed. Orthogonal’s Randy Horton collaborated with Sub Datta, Delphine Zurkiya and Josh Copp from McKinsey & Company on a session at the conference.

This Is Not Your Grandmother’s Medical Device: What Happens When Medical Device Software, Data and Connectivity Spurs New MedTech Business and Regulatory Strategies?” explored the cloud, AI/ML, FHIR, web services integration and other modern computing technologies, and how incorporating these technologies into our Software as a Medical Device (SaMD), Digital Therapeutics (DTx) and connected medical device systems create new business opportunities, as well as new challenges.
